Tarta La Bouie with Grilled Apples

Recipe provided by Sam Carroll and Cody Carroll

  • Difficulty: Intermediate
  • Servings: 8 to 10 portions
  • Nutrition per Serving (1 of 10): Calories 500, Total Fat 22 g, Saturated Fat 14 g, Carbohydrates 70 g, Dietary Fiber 2 g, Sugar 40 g, Protein 7 g, Cholesterol 98 mg, Sodium 255 mg
  • Total time: 7 hr 5 min (including cooling and chilling)
  • Active preparation: 1 hr 5 min

Crust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up (1 stick) salted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g plus 1 large egg yolk
  • 1 tablespoon whole milk
  •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our, plus extra for dusting
  • 2 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• Pinch of kosher salt

Filling Ingredients:

  • 3 cups half-and-half
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/3 cup cornstarch
  • 1 teaspoon fresh lemon zest
  • Seeds from 1 vanilla bean
  • Pinch of kosher salt

Apples:

  • 2 apples, cut into quarters
  • 3 tablespoons salted butter, melted
  • 1 heaping teaspoon light brown sugar

Topping:

  • Honey, for drizzling
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ar, for dusting

Special Equipment:

A deep-dish pie pan

  1. Prepare the crust: In a stand mixer, cream soft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Add the egg, egg yolk, milk, and vanilla; beat until fully combined and smooth.
  2. Combine dry ingredients: Whisk flour,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l. Gradually mix into the wet ingredients in two additions until the dough pulls away from the bowl sides. Form into a disc, wrap in plastic, and chill for at least 30 minutes or up to 24 hours. Imagine the flaky, golden crust waiting to cradle your creamy filling!
  3. Make the filling: In a saucepan, whisk half-and-half, sugar, cornstarch, lemon zest, vanilla seeds, and salt. Bring to a boil over medium heat, whisking constantly, then simmer 2 minutes until thickened. Cool slightly, press plastic wrap on the surface, and chill completely. This silky custard is the heart of the dessertpure indulgence.
  4. Grill the apples: Preheat grill to medium. Toss apple quarters with melted butter and brown sugar. Grill 3-4 minutes per side until caramelized and fragrant. Cool, then slice thinly lengthwise. The smoky sweetness will elevate every bite!
  5. Assemble and bake: Preheat oven to 350F (175C). Let dough rest 5 minutes, roll to 1/4-inch thick on floured surface, and fit into deep-dish pie pan. Trim and crimp edges.
  6. Whisk filling smooth, pour into crust, and bake 30-35 minutes until crust is golden (filling will jiggle slightly). Cool completely, then chill 2-4 hours until set.
  7. Serve with flair: Top with grilled apple slices, drizzle generously with honey, and dust with powdered sugar. Slice and savor this showstopping treatyour guests will be wowed!
